The answer is C, 25% increase. To find the increase, subtract starting value (780) from the final value (975). It equals out to be 195. Divide 195 by the starting value which turns out to be 0.25. Then, multiply 0.25 by 100 which equals out to be 25.

The equation 3x - 2y = 8 and 6x - 4y = 16 are systems of equations with infinite solutions.
A linear system of equations can have (a)unique solutions, (b) infinite number of solutions, or (c) no solution.
For it to have infinite number of solutions, the graph of the equations must intercept with each other at infinite points, leaving the two graphs overlaying each other.
Given the equation, 3x - 2y = 8, the other equation in a linear system to have infinite number of solutions with it must be the exact same line.
To do this, simply multiply the whole equation with a real number.
Example:
Multiplying the whole equation by 2 gives 6x - 4y = 16.
Now, 3x - 2y = 8 and 6x - 4y = 16 are equations in a linear system with infinite number of solutions.
